Channel steel, a metal framing component widely used in mechanical, electrical and plumbing installations, features uniformly spaced slots along its length. This distinctive design enables easy structural assembly, component installation and position adjustments without welding, significantly improving construction efficiency and flexibility.
The slotted design provides exceptional adaptability, allowing installers to quickly create adjustable support systems. Whether securing conduits, supporting piping or constructing solar panel frameworks, channel steel has become the preferred choice for professionals worldwide.
